Saint Mary of Sorrows German Catholic Church

     "The baptismal records of St. Mary of Sorrows Catholic Church in Buffalo list George Francis Zenner, son of George Joseph Zenner and Christine Campbell, as having been born January 20, 1889. Godparents are listed as Fr. J. Zenner and Magdalena Zenner." - Source: Notes for Chart Eisenman files pgs. 4 of 8.

     The Church of the Seven Dolors or St. Mary of Sorrows laid its cornerstone on June 18, 1887 at the corner of Gennessee and Rich Streets, Buffalo, New York, and was completed in 1891. Two years after the cornerstone was laid in 1887, the baptism of George Francis Zenner aka Frank Joseph Zenner occured in 1889 at St. Mary of Sorrows.

History of Old Zion Church, (near Greensburg, Westmoreland County, Pa)

John (Wolfe), born Feb 17, 1774, baptized Feb 9, 1778. Elizabeth (twin) born July 23, 1776, baptized Feb 9, 1778. Godparents Jacob Zehner (Zenner) and Catherine his wife. Anna Maria, (Twin) born July 23, 1776 baptized Feb 9, 1778. Godparents George Zehner (Zenner) and Anna Maria, his wife. John Christan, born Feb 20, 1778; baptized Jan 23, 1779; Godparents, John Krebs and Sophia Serring, whom the record has as "in single status." [Sayers Book, December 31, 2007]
